Bathandanga Population - Pakur, Jharkhand
Bathandanga is a medium size village located in Maheshpur Block of Pakur district, Jharkhand with total 130 families residing. The Bathandanga village has population of 573 of which 281 are males while 292 are females as per Population Census 2011.In Bathandanga village population of children with age 0-6 is 115 which makes up 20.07 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Bathandanga village is 1039 which is higher than Jharkhand state average of 948. Child Sex Ratio for the Bathandanga as per census is 1054, higher than Jharkhand average of 948.
Bathandanga village has lower literacy rate compared to Jharkhand. In 2011, literacy rate of Bathandanga village was 43.01 % compared to 66.41 % of Jharkhand. In Bathandanga Male literacy stands at 55.11 % while female literacy rate was 31.33 %.

Bathandanga Data
| Particulars | Total | Male | Female |
|---|---|---|---|
| Total No. of Houses | 130 | - | - |
| Population | 573 | 281 | 292 |
| Child (0-6) | 115 | 56 | 59 |
| Schedule Caste | 0 | 0 | 0 |
| Schedule Tribe | 554 | 272 | 282 |
| Literacy | 43.01 % | 55.11 % | 31.33 % |
| Total Workers | 328 | 162 | 166 |
| Main Worker | 100 | - | - |
| Marginal Worker | 228 | 99 | 129 |
